Kevin Nealon’s earnings come from multiple streams, including his acting roles, stand-up comedy, and television specials. He made his TV debut on The Tonight Show in 1984, but it was his time on Saturday Night Live that skyrocketed his career.
Nealon earned a significant income from his nine-season run on SNL, where he not only acted but also played a key role as a Weekend Update anchor. Over the years, this platform helped him build a robust comedy career.
Nealon’s comedic contributions continued with Weeds, where he played Doug Wilson for 8 seasons. This show brought him steady income and fame, further solidifying his place in Hollywood. Beyond his TV roles, Nealon has done several stand-up comedy specials, such as “Now Hear Me Out!” and “Whelmed, But Not Overly”, both of which have contributed to his wealth.

How Does Kevin Nealon Make Money from Real Estate?
Real estate is another key contributor to Kevin Nealon’s financial success. In 2019, he and his wife, Susan Yeagley, purchased a $4.35 million home in the prestigious Pacific Palisades neighborhood of Los Angeles. This luxurious property is part of a larger trend of Hollywood celebrities investing in real estate. The couple later listed the property for just under $5 million, showing that Nealon knows how to leverage property investments for profit.

Kevin Nealon’s Financial Portfolio Beyond TV and Movies
Kevin Nealon’s financial portfolio extends beyond his TV and movie earnings. His comedy specials have continued to provide a solid revenue stream, with special releases like “Kevin Nealon: Now Hear Me Out!” being popular on platforms like Netflix. Additionally, Nealon’s artistic endeavors, including caricature sketches and his Instagram art page, have opened new income sources for him.
Nealon’s book, “Yes, You’re Pregnant, But What About Me?”, released in 2008, further diversified his income. The memoir provided both financial returns and increased public visibility.
